Surface type and project scope

Selecting the best size trowel for finishing drywall largely depends on the size of the surface and the scope of the project. For larger drywall surfaces or extensive repair jobs, a wider trowel is advantageous as it covers more area quickly and helps apply joint compound evenly. In contrast, smaller projects or tight spaces benefit from a narrower trowel that offers greater control and precision.

The thickness of the joint compound being applied also influences the choice; thicker layers typically require a broader trowel to smooth effectively, while thinner coats can be managed well with a smaller one. When deciding, consider how much area you will be working on and the consistency of the compound to achieve a smooth, professional drywall finish without wasting compound or effort.

Understanding trowel sizes for drywall finishing

Choosing the right trowel size plays a key role in drywall finishing tasks, impacting both control and precision during application. Common sizes for drywall trowels often range from smaller 6-inch to larger 14-inch blades, each suited to different parts of the finishing process. Smaller trowels offer greater maneuverability and are ideal for tight corners and detail work, while wider blades cover more surface area, making them preferable for broad, flat wall sections.

The distinction between taping and finishing trowels is also significant; taping trowels typically have a stiffer blade and are used to embed drywall tape into joint compound, requiring accuracy and firm pressure. Finishing trowels, on the other hand, usually have a more flexible blade allowing for smooth feathering and blending of compound layers to create a polished, seamless surface.

When selecting a trowel for finishing drywall, balancing blade width with the specific stage of your project helps achieve a clean and professional look, while also ensuring comfortable handling and reduced fatigue during extended use.

Maintenance and longevity

When choosing the right size trowel for finishing drywall, maintaining it properly can extend its usability and performance. Cleaning and storage tips play a significant role in keeping the tool in good condition; rinsing the trowel promptly after use to remove drywall compound and drying it thoroughly prevents rust and buildup.

Over time, the blade might lose its smooth edge, and options for blade sharpening or replacement can restore the trowel’s functionality without needing a full replacement. Recognizing signs it’s time to replace your trowel includes visible dents, warping, or persistent rough edges that affect the finish quality.

Taking care of these aspects ensures consistent results and prolongs the tool’s lifecycle when finishing drywall surfaces.

What Is The Best Size Trowel For Finishing Drywall Seams?

The best size trowel for finishing drywall seams is typically a 6-inch taping knife. This size provides an ideal balance between control and coverage, allowing for smooth application of joint compound over seams without excessive spillage. It’s large enough to cover seams efficiently but still manageable for detailed work. For larger areas or second and third coats, a 10 or 12-inch taping knife can be used to feather out the compound and achieve a seamless finish. Using the right trowel size helps ensure a professional, smooth drywall surface.

Which Trowel Sizes Are Recommended For Applying Joint Compound On Drywall?

For applying joint compound on drywall, commonly recommended trowel or drywall knife sizes range from 6 to 12 inches. A 6-inch knife is ideal for small patching jobs and tight corners, offering precision and control. For standard drywall seams, an 8 to 10-inch knife works well to spread the compound evenly and feather the edges smoothly. Larger sizes, such as 12 inches, are best for finishing broader areas and achieving a uniform surface quickly. Choosing the right size depends on the task, ensuring efficient application and a professional finish.
